Costs at Lebanon Valley College

Tuition, fees, room, and board are determined annually, usually in February, for the following academic year.

Full Time Students

The charges for full time students for 2009-2010 are:

  Resident Commuter
Tuition and fees $30,490 $30,390
Room and board $8,080 $0
Total $38,570 $30,390

The annual costs are generally divided into two payments: one for each semester.

In addition, students should anticipate other expenses for books, transportation, personal and miscellaneous educational items. Those expenses are estimated to be approximately $2,900 for resident students, $10,420 for students living off-campus and $6,400 for commuting students living with their parents. These estimated costs are included in the cost of attendance when determining eligibility for financial aid.

Part Time and Graduate Students

2009-2010 Current Semester Fees***

Part-time undergraduate: Day $500/credit hour*
Part-time undergraduate: Evening/Weekend $360/credit hour*
Part-time graduate: M.B.A. $420/credit hour
Part-time graduate: M.S.E. $410/credit hour
Part-time graduate: M.M.E. $410/credit hour
Private Music Instruction (1/2 hour lesson) $500/credit hour
Laboratory fee $60/lab course
Auditing Fees charged at part-time rate (as listed above)
LVC alumni, high school students, senior citizens (age 62 or older) **$250/credit hour

*12 or more credit hours per semester constitute full-time undergraduate status and are charged at the full-time rate.

**Discounted tuition rates apply for all part time courses (day, evening, and weekend) except graduate courses, individual music instruction, independent study, internships, and physical therapy courses.

***2009-2010 Current Semester Fees are effective with courses scheduled in the fall 2009 semester.
